From 2e50262b724deb86fd29353658d4ca13b6396510 Mon Sep 17 00:00:00 2001 From: Imanol-Mikel Barba Sabariego Date: Sat, 28 May 2016 21:19:13 +0200 Subject: [PATCH] Added warning message if server full. --- check_csgo/check_csgo.cpp | 11 +++++++++++ 1 file changed, 11 insertions(+), 0 deletions(-) diff --git a/check_csgo/check_csgo.cpp b/check_csgo/check_csgo.cpp index 6532a6d..660b19b 100755 --- a/check_csgo/check_csgo.cpp +++ b/check_csgo/check_csgo.cpp @@ -84,6 +84,13 @@ int check_csgo(char *hostname, uint16_t port, SERVERINFO *server_info) delete[] (response->data-HDR_SIZE); delete response; + server_info->players = 18; + + if(server_info->players == server_info->max_players) + { + return 1; + } + return 0; } @@ -145,6 +152,10 @@ int main(int argc, char **argv) << " " << (int)server_info.players << "/" << (int)server_info.max_players << " players" << endl ; break; + case 1: + cout << " WARNING - Server is full"; + break; + case 2: cout << " CRITICAL - No response"; break; -- libgit2 0.22.2